The London Borough of Lambeth

 
The London Borough of Lambeth

Lambeth Stretching from the South Bank of the Thames to the suburbs of Streatham and Norwood, Lambeth is bursting with exciting attractions. Brixton, one of the borough's most multi-cultural areas has a thriving shopping centre and market selling ethnic foods, household goods, jewellery and second-hand goods. Its thriving nightlife makes it the heart of London's urban scene, and it also has the best live venue in London, the Brixton Academy. Another part of the borough, Kennington, is famous for the Oval Cricket Ground, where county and test cricket matches are played. Famous local figures include Charlie Chaplin who was born there in 1889.
